首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

更改ViewController并重启应用程序

是指在iOS开发中,通过修改视图控制器(ViewController)的代码,并重新启动应用程序来实现对界面的修改和更新。

视图控制器是iOS应用程序中负责管理界面和处理用户交互的核心组件之一。通过更改视图控制器的代码,可以实现对界面布局、样式、行为等方面的修改。

重启应用程序是指在应用程序运行过程中,重新启动应用程序以使修改生效。在iOS开发中,可以通过重新启动应用程序来加载最新的代码和资源,从而实现对界面的更新。

更改ViewController并重启应用程序的步骤如下:

  1. 打开Xcode开发工具,找到对应的项目文件。
  2. 在项目文件中找到需要修改的ViewController文件。
  3. 根据需求修改ViewController的代码,可以修改界面布局、添加新的控件、修改控件属性等。
  4. 保存修改后的代码,并关闭Xcode开发工具。
  5. 在iOS模拟器或真机上,找到并关闭当前运行的应用程序。
  6. 重新打开应用程序,即可看到对ViewController的修改生效。

更改ViewController并重启应用程序的应用场景包括但不限于:

  1. 修改界面布局:可以通过更改ViewController的代码来调整界面元素的位置、大小、排列方式,以适应不同的屏幕尺寸和方向。
  2. 添加新的功能:可以通过更改ViewController的代码来添加新的控件、事件处理逻辑,以实现新的功能需求。
  3. 优化用户体验:可以通过更改ViewController的代码来改善用户界面的交互方式、动画效果,提升用户体验。
  4. 修复Bug:可以通过更改ViewController的代码来修复已知的界面显示或交互问题,提高应用程序的稳定性和可靠性。

腾讯云提供了一系列与移动应用开发相关的云服务和产品,包括移动应用开发平台、移动推送服务、移动分析服务等。具体推荐的产品和产品介绍链接地址如下:

  1. 腾讯移动应用开发平台:提供了一站式的移动应用开发解决方案,包括应用开发、测试、发布、运营等环节。详情请参考:腾讯移动应用开发平台
  2. 腾讯移动推送服务:提供了高效可靠的移动消息推送服务,帮助开发者实现消息推送功能。详情请参考:腾讯移动推送服务
  3. 腾讯移动分析服务:提供了全面的移动应用数据分析服务,帮助开发者了解用户行为、应用性能等关键指标。详情请参考:腾讯移动分析服务

请注意,以上推荐的腾讯云产品仅供参考,具体选择和使用需根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Docker容器——安装Redis,实现可更改配置

    Docker容器——安装Redis,实现可更改配置 背景 日常我们开发时,我们会遇到各种各样的奇奇怪怪的问题(踩坑o(╯□╰)o),这个常见问题系列就是我日常遇到的一些问题的记录文章系列,这里整理汇总后分享给大家...至此我们就可以正常连接宿主机IP:6379进行使用redis了,而有时我们需要进行配置redis的配置文件,使其具备一些特性,比如连接需要密码,这时我们就需要将其配置文件设置在宿主机中或者固定存储中,下面我们就开始将配置文件更改读取为宿主机...docker-local/ sudo chown -R cnhuashao:cnhuashao /docker-local 4、创建一个redis目录和其数据存储目录,用于我们存储本地配置文件和数据,便于更改维护使用...-d 后台运行该容器 redis-server /user/local/etc/redis/redis.conf 指定运行redis-server追加配置文件地址。...至此我们就完成了redis的配置,可以在宿主机中的/docker-local/redis/redis.conf中进行更改相关的配置来满足我们的需求了。 更多信息可参考官方文档

    1.2K10

    更改Linux默认端口,设置仅允许密钥登录

    接上一篇文章,更改Linux默认端口,防止被恶意扫描 为了服务器安全。我们接着搞 上步骤: 一:首先运行Xshell5来生成密钥。如图: 一直如图操作: 密码自行决定是否设置,推荐默认。.../bin/bash #更改ssh连接端口开启密钥登陆工具 rm $0 echo "请输入新的SSH端口:" read ss echo "您输入的端口为$ss,确认请回车,否则请ctrl+c退出...测试过大部分机器,如果不通过,请检查下防火墙是否开放端口,如果嫌麻烦,可以不更改端口,依然使用22端口。 有问题欢迎与我讨论,对于Putty的密钥来说,百度搜一下,key转pub就行。...» 本文链接:更改Linux默认端口,设置仅允许密钥登录 » 转载请注明来源:刺客博客

    2.7K50

    Magniber勒索软件已更改漏洞,尝试绕过行为检测

    今年年初,ASEC分析团队发布了一份关于Magniber恶意软件的研究报告,详细阐述了Magniber开发者用来传播勒索软件时所使用的漏洞变化情况。...在对漏洞PoC代码和传播恶意软件所使用的漏洞脚本进行比对的过程中,研究人员发现变量名中存在卷积,但没有发现代码中的更改。...Magniber的开发人员不仅试图更改用于传播脚本的漏洞,还试图应用各种更改来绕过基于行为的V3检测。...比如说,如果攻击者分配SysCall索引,直接调用KiFastSystemCall,而不是通过正常的API调用来绕过反恶意软件所挂钩的特定API,则这种情况可视为“Heaven’s Gate”攻击。...这两个检测功能已于2020年12月17日分发到了所有V3用户,而且该漏洞以及Magniber用来绕过钩子的注入技术可以在通过V3的行为引擎加密之前被预先检测阻止执行。

    1.3K20

    使用Python检测绕过Web应用程序防火墙

    在本文中我将教大家编写一个简单的python脚本,以帮助我们完成检测任务绕过防火墙。 步骤1:定义HTML文档和PHP脚本!...在以上的HTML文档中,我们只定义了一个表单输入字段,我们将利用该字段注入我们的恶意payload,通过检查http响应信息来判断目标是否部署了Web应用防火墙。...步骤4:提交表单记录响应 下面我们提交此表单记录响应信息: maliciousRequest.submit() response = maliciousRequest.response().read...可以看到payload被打印在了HTML文档中,这也说明应用程序代码中没有任何的过滤机制,并且由于没有防火墙的保护,我们的恶意请求也未被阻止。...随着Javascript的日趋复杂,我们可以用它来构建数千种的payload逐一进行尝试,以绕过防火墙的检测。需要说明的是如果防护墙规则被明确定义,那么该方法可能会失效。

    2.4K50

    完美解决安装博途无限提醒重启,更新软件和支持包

    6.执行以上操作并在注册表中删除 "PendingFileRenameOperations" 后,直接执行应用程序的安装将不再提示重启。...如果重启后仍要求重启,可以不选择重启,然后手动重启电脑,重启后首先执行上面的操作,然后,在你安装一开始解压的TEMP文件夹里找到.exe的安装文件进行手动安装,就可以了。...P.S. 20210702经验更新: 如果注册表里面没有"PendingFileRenameOperations",还是 安装提示重启.并且重启也没有用.那就手动添加该"PendingFileRenameOperations...将打开“TIA Updater”对话框显示可用的更新。 或者: 在“选项”(Options) 菜单中,选择“设置”(Settings) 命令。 “设置”(Settings) 窗口将显示在工作区内。...将打开“TIA Updater”对话框显示可用的更新。

    18.8K21
    领券